| Thursday, 31 January, 2002, 15:03 GMT Broadcast Awards winners in full ![]() The paedophile spoof received hundreds of complaints The winners of the Broadcast Awards have been announced, with Channel 4's controversial show Brass Eye, a spoof on how the media treats paedophilia, winning best comedy. Best multichannel programme Banzai (Radar/RDF Media for C4) Best children's programme Newsround (CBBC for BBC One) Best drama series or serial Never Never (Company Pictures for Channel 4) Best drama one-off Tina Takes a Break (Blast!
